About the Role
Spin’s Policy Initiatives team develops programs to lay the groundwork for making micromobility safer for riders, healthier for our communities, and accessible to all. We focus on street infrastructure improvements, sustainability, safety, and equity. Spin’s Streets and Equity group focuses on delivering projects to make our streets safe, livable, and just.
This individual will be responsible for developing our Equity program efforts across all of our markets, developing programs and partnerships that focus on transportation justice and equity. The ideal person will be a passionate urbanist seeking to work with communities and advocates so Spin can better serve the needs of communities of concern, especially those with limited incomes, the un(der)banked, and those who face disproportionate challenges with getting where they need to be.
Responsibilities
- Build and implement an equity roadmap of projects and programs that will guide inputs into city RFP processes.
- Work cross-functionally with the Partnerships, Operations, and Finance teams to shape equity proposals in RFPs.
- Work cross-functionally with the Policy Initiatives, Product, Operations, and Partnerships teams to help administer Spin Access (Spin’s existing low income discount program).
- Work with leaders in the equity space to obtain feedback and support for Spin’s equity programs.
- Oversee relevant equity related studies and develop equity research roadmap.
- Scope, oversee and manage Spin Streets projects that focus on equity and mobility justice.
- Develop and communicate externally facing equity program content for cities and other relevant partners.
